
Raining in the Mountain
Directed by King Hu
Produced by Lo & Hu Company Productions Ltd.
A wuxia heist film set in a Ming Dynasty monastery, balancing martial action with spiritual intrigue as hidden agendas clash beneath a veneer of religious ceremony.
In Ming Dynasty China, the retiring abbot of a Buddhist monastery invites two dignitaries to help him choose a successor, not suspecting that both of them have hired help to steal a priceless parchment kept in the temple.
